...5:30pm, just finished cooking dinner for my wife but she's not home yet. I've recently given up smoking, I'm itching for something...what to do? I need to take photos, can't think about that cigarette. Gotta go, gotta go....
Threw on my helmet and rode to the nearest scenic sight by the coast. Hopped off the bike and started trekking down the rocky slopes. The clouds look interesting but it's also drizzling...that won't stop me, I've got a D2x it's tough enough...keep moving. Ah finally, here I am. The light just about gone, my tripod set up, polarizer filter on...snap!
In case you're freaking out about the darkish matter under the water...it's seaweed. And the colours were wild like you see here because of the time of day.
